Root causes of the problem

There are several possible reasons why one side of an electric blanket may stop working. Some of the most common causes are here:

  1. Broken or damaged heating element: The heating element in an electric blanket is responsible for generating and distributing heat. If the element on one side of the blanket is broken or damaged, that side of the blanket may not work properly.
  2. Broken or damaged wire: The wires that run through the electric blanket can become damaged or broken over time, especially if the blanket is folded or crumpled while in use or storage. If a wire on one side of the blanket is broken, that side of the blanket may not work.
  3. Control unit malfunction: The control unit of an electric blanket is responsible for regulating the temperature and turning the blanket on and off. If the control unit on one side of the blanket is malfunctioning, that side of the blanket may not work properly.
  4. Power supply issues: If the power supply to the electric blanket is interrupted or not functioning properly, one side of the blanket may stop working.
  5. User error: Sometimes, the problem with one side of an electric blanket not working is simply user error. For example, if the controls are not set properly, or if one side of the blanket is not plugged in, that side of the blanket will not work.

Working Solutions

There are several solutions that you can try if one side of your electric blanket is not working. Here are some common solutions:

  1. Check the connections: The first step to fixing a one-sided electric blanket is to make sure that all the connections are secure. Check the plug connections, control unit, and wiring on the affected side of the blanket to ensure that everything is connected properly.
  2. Replace the control unit: If the control unit is malfunctioning, replacing it may fix the problem. You can purchase a replacement control unit from the manufacturer or from an electronics store.
  3. Repair the heating element or wire: If the heating element or wire on one side of the electric blanket is broken, it may be possible to repair it. You can use a multimeter to test the continuity of the wires and identify the damaged wire. Once identified, you can splice in a new wire and re-solder the connection.
  4. Replace the electric blanket: If none of the above solutions work, you may need to replace the electric blanket. In some cases, it may be more cost-effective to replace the blanket rather than trying to repair it.
  5. Practice proper care and maintenance: To prevent future issues with your electric blanket, it is important to practice proper care and maintenance. This includes avoiding folding or crumpling the blanket while in use or storage, following the manufacturer’s instructions for washing and drying, and inspecting the blanket regularly for any signs of wear or damage.

Precautions to Take While Troubleshooting Electric Blanket Issues

When troubleshooting an electric blanket issue, it is important to take some precautions to avoid any potential safety hazards. Here are some precautions to take while troubleshooting electric blanket issues:

Unplug the blanket

Before attempting any repairs or inspections, make sure to unplug the electric blanket from the power source. This will prevent the risk of electrical shock.

Use proper tools and equipment

Use proper tools and equipment, such as a multimeter and soldering iron, when repairing an electric blanket. Do not use tools that are not designed for electrical repairs, as this could lead to further damage or safety hazards.

Do not fold or crumple the blanket

When troubleshooting an electric blanket, make sure to lay it out flat and avoid folding or crumpling it. Folding or crumpling the blanket can damage the wires and heating element.

Do not immerse the blanket in water

Avoid immersing the electric blanket in water, as this can damage the electrical components and increase the risk of electrical shock.

Follow manufacturer instructions

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for troubleshooting, repairing, and maintaining the electric blanket. These instructions will ensure that you take the appropriate steps to fix the issue while minimizing safety risks.
